IIS部署FLASK网站】的更多相关文章

在 Windows 平台部署基于 Python 的网站是一件非常折腾的事情,Linux/Unix 平台下有很多选择,本文记录了 Flask 部署到 IIS 的主要步骤,希望对你有所帮助. 涉及工具和平台 Windows 7 x64 Python 3.4+ Flask 完成 Hello Flask 网站 这是一个最简单的 Flask 网站: # hello.py from flask import Flask app=Flask(__name__) @app.route('/',methods=[…
  本文主要介绍在Windows Server 2012R2上通过IIS部署Flask项目的过程,以及对TTFB延迟大问题的思考.关于如何申请云服务器,注册(子)域名,备案,开放云服务器端口,获取SSL证书等不做介绍,感兴趣可以参考通过二级域名解决1台云服务器搭建多个公众号后端服务的问题. 一.部署环境准备 1.操作系统和IIS版本 操作系统的版本是Windows Server 2012R2,IIS版本为8.5.9600.16384: 2.CGI和ISAPI安装 通过服务器管理器添加角色和功能,…
关于火狐浏览器访问本机IIS部署的网站弹出“此地址使用了一个通常用于网络浏览以外目的的端口.出于安全原因,Firefox 取消了该请求”这个错误(错误截图如下): 解决方法如下: 1.打开火狐浏览器,在地址烂输入“about:config” 2.然后在“首选项名称”的下方单击右键,选择“新建”>“字符串”,在弹出框输入“network.security.ports.banned.override”,单击“确定” 3.然后再在弹出的“输入字符串的值”对话框中输入IIS部署网站设置的端口,如:103…
利用IIS部署WEB网站以及解决CSS/JS不能显示问题 转载声明:http://blog.sina.com.cn/s/blog_a001e5980101b4kt.html vs中正常IIS发布网站后css样式.图片丢失jQuery报错 $ is not defined 转载声明:https://www.cnblogs.com/dansediao/p/5432445.html…
Flask是Python应用于WEB开发的第三方开源框架,以设计简单高效著称.我也尝试过Django,相对于Flask显得更加全面同样也更加笨重,并且我也不需要它的后台管理功能,因此选择了Flask作为我的首选开发框架. 首先,先介绍结果,实现的效果如下图(安全考虑屏蔽相关信息).这个网站设计的相关背景:通过web网站访问的方式了解通过机器学习方法得到的IT系统变更风险数据.相关的数据通过其他工具已经生成.这个网站的主要目的就是展示,后期也有计划上线人工点评的功能来补充机器学习的不足. 从接到这…
当服务器修改用户密码时,需要修改iis上部署的跟此用户权限有关的所有网站,选择网站——右击——应用程序管理——高级设置——物理路径凭证——特定用户——修改用户名和密码.…
一开始在“管理工具”下找不到IIS的快捷方式,是因为系统默认未打开IIS功能,所以首先打开IIS功能: 为避免出现未知的麻烦,建议将IIS下的所有项都勾上: 创建IIS桌面快捷方式: 添加网站托管: 报错:在计算机"."上没有找到服务WAS. 解决办法:打开Framwork3.5.1. 为了方便调试,需要显示具体错误报告,所以要在浏览器中设置将“显示友好http错误信息”这项的勾去掉. 报错:500.21,使用了托管的处理程序,但是未安装或未完整安装ASP.NET. 解决办法: 进入C…
Windows Server使用IIS 6.0配置ASP动态Web网站 http://jingyan.baidu.com/article/c1a3101ee43ae9de656debb4.html https://www.baidu.com/link?url=cq6wz3tdNsPlk_8Txxbl240qgXrdvoIXh-WGzGmJ7c-5WWl2tI5gioQe0BI1p2zhF7n7EAwyr6XpJsSd-MLHo_&wd=&eqid=bd7e062f0001027c00000…
先参考http://python.jobbole.com/87655/,会发现失败. 再参考https://blog.csdn.net/david_lee13/article/details/81985847,会发现需要添加映射模块. 最后需要注意的是,C:\Anaconda3\python.exe|C:\Anaconda3\Lib\site-packages\wfastcgi.py,不带"". 在IIS种启动网站就可以正常访问了!…
IIS上部署MVC网站,打开后ExtensionlessUrlHandler-Integrated-4.0解决方法 IIS上部署MVC网站,打开后500错误:处理程序“ExtensionlessUrlHandler-Integrated-4.0”在其模块列表中有一个错误模块“ManagedPipelineHandler” 解决方法如下: 以管理员运行下面的命令注册: 32位机器: C:\Windows\Microsoft.NET\Framework\v4.0.30319\aspnet_regii…